Also question is, how do you sterilize titanium jewelry?

Moreover, how can I clean my titanium ring at home? Soak them in a bowl of water with mild soap such as baby soap or dish soap. Brush gently with a soft brush, then rinse and dry with a microfiber cloth. Note that cleaning procedures for titanium rings with other gemstones such as opals or coral will be different.

In respect to this, how do you clean tarnished titanium?

Cleaning Titanium:

Liquid dish soap can remove any dirt and grease build up, and an ammonia glass cleaner can be used for shine. Wash and dry your titanium wedding band with a soft towel or lint-free cloth.

Does black titanium wear off?

Will the color fade or wear on my titanium ring? Titanium itself will not change color or tarnish. However, any colored (anodized) area is not scratch resistant. … Black titanium is not anodized.

Can you wear titanium in the shower?

Showering/Bathing with Jewelry

If your jewelry is gold, silver, platinum, palladium, stainless steel, or titanium, you‘re safe to shower with it. Other metals like copper, brass, bronze, or other base metals shouldn’t go in the shower as they can turn your skin green.

What can I clean titanium with?

Windex and similar ammonia glass cleaners work well on titanium. Simply spray the cleaner on a soft cloth, rub the ring clean, and rinse the ring with water.

Can you polish scratches out of titanium?

After cleaning the titanium surface, apply the jewelry polish to the scratched area until the scratch is filled, then polish the surface for a smooth finish. … The most cost-effective method is the eraser method, this involves using a common pencil eraser to buff the titanium and remove light scratches.

How do you clean a titanium flat iron?

How you’re Flat Iron cleaning at home

  1. Heat the flat iron a little, or heat it and leave it to cool. …
  2. Dampen a small terrycloth towel with warm water. …
  3. Wipe down the plates until there is no more buildup on them. …
  4. Clean off any residue around the sides or edges. …
  5. Let the flat iron dry thoroughly before using it.

Can you polish titanium watch?

Apply an acid-free metal polish cream to the dry surface of the titanium with a clean, soft cloth according to the manufacturer’s instructions — typically, you rub the polish on in a circular motion and buff it off, similar to a car wax. This is only necessary if your watchband is scratched.
